Description
Experience the comforting, rich flavors of classic Italian lasagna in an easy one-pot soup. This gluten-free meal features tender noodles, savory ground beef, and a vibrant tomato broth, capturing the essence of a baked lasagna without the tedious layering process. Perfect for busy weeknights, this hearty dish delivers a restaurant-quality taste in under an hour, making it an ideal choice for families looking for a wholesome and satisfying dinner option.
Ingredients
1 lb ground beef
8 oz gluten-free lasagna sheets, broken into pieces
6 cups beef broth (certified gluten-free)
28 oz crushed tomatoes
1 medium onion, finely di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
2 tsp Italian seasoning
1 cup ricotta cheese
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
Heat a large stockpot over medium-high heat.
Add ground beef and brown thoroughly, breaking into small crumbles.
Drain excess fat from the pot.
Add diced onions and sauté until translucent.
Stir in minced garlic and cook for one minute until fragrant.
Pour in beef broth and crushed tomatoes.
Add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
Bring mixture to a gentle boil.
Add broken lasagna sheets and simmer until noodles are tender, about 10-12 minutes.
Ladle into bowls and top with a dollop of ricotta cheese before serving.
Notes
Ensure your beef broth is certified gluten-free as some commercial stocks contain hidden gluten additives. For extra richness, you can stir a handful of fresh spinach into the soup during the last minute of cooking.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days; note that gluten-free noodles may soften further upon reheating.
